U+2F2F "⼯" Kangxi Radical Work is a graphic representation of the Kangxi radical number 48, which symbolizes work, labor, or craftsmanship, often appearing as a component in Chinese characters related to these concepts. This radical originates from the traditional Kangxi dictionary classification and is derived from an ancient pictograph of a carpenter's square or a tool, reflecting its connection to manual skill and effort. In modern usage, it serves as a building block in the writing system for over 50,000 Chinese characters, where it can denote meanings like industry, construction, or artistry. Its encoded form in Unicode ensures consistent digital representation across platforms for linguistic and educational purposes.
